Question
If ABC and DEF are two triangles such that ΔABC \[\cong\] ΔFDE and AB = 5cm, ∠B = 40°
Options
DF = 5cm, ∠F = 60°
DE = 5cm, ∠E = 60°
DF = 5cm, ∠E = 60°
DE = 5cm, ∠D = 40°
Advertisements
Solution
It is given that ΔABC \[\cong\] ΔFDE and AB = 5 CM . ∠B = 40 , and ∠A = 80°
So AB = FD and ∠C = ∠E
Now, in triangle ABC,
∠A +∠B +∠C = 180°
⇒ 80 + 40 + ∠C = 180°
⇒ ∠C = 60°
Therefore,
DF = 5cm, ∠E = 60°
